Defendant waived indictment and pleaded guilty to a superior court information charging her with criminal possession of a forged instrument in the second degree. County Court sentenced defendant, as second felony offender, to a prison term of 2 to 4 years. Defendant appeals.
Defendant's sole contention is that the sentence is harsh and excessive, particularly in light of her history of controlled substance abuse, and should be modified to a period of parole supervision...
